Aggiungi al carrelloPaperback. Condizione: New. Print on Demand. This book seeks to expand a reader's knowledge of Protestant Episcopal Church (PEC) practices and customs. It provides convincing answers to common questions surrounding this denomination's beliefs and rituals. The author delves into the historical context of the PEC, explaining how its unique practices often stem from ancient religious customs or biblical teachings rather than recent innovations. It further discusses the depth of PEC theology, providing a thoughtful exploration of the denomination's position on issues such as infant baptism, confirmation, and the role of ordained ministers. The author also elucidates the significance of the church building itself, emphasizing not only its sacred purpose but also its architectural and historical value. Ultimately, the book aims to foster a deeper understanding of the PEC's rich and meaningful traditions.
